Shafee to challenge AG's bid to cite him for contempt


Lawyer Muhammad Shafee Abdullah will file an application to set aside the leave granted to attorney-general Tommy Thomas to cite him for contempt for his comments on the ongoing case against his client, former prime minister Najib Abdul Razak.
This was relayed by Shafee's lawyer David Matthews to High Court judge Mohd Firuz Jaffril in Kuala Lumpur today, according to senior federal counsel Shamsul Bolhassan.
"He has yet to file the application," Shamsul said, adding that the court was informed that Shafee needs at least three weeks to file the application.
“(The court then directed that) Shafee's lawyers file the application by April 15, we (the prosecution) file a reply to the application by April 29, and May 6 for reply (from Shafee to the prosecution)," he said.
Speaking to reporters after the matter came up for case management, Shamsul noted that the court had earlier fixed May 23 to hear Shafee's application. 
Shafee himself was not present in court as he is currently in Sydney. Lawyer Karen Cheah held a watching brief for the Malaysian Bar.
On March 1, the High Court in Kuala Lumpur granted leave to Thomas to proceed with his bid to cite Shafee for contempt over comments the latter made in a KiniTV video entitled "Shafee: This is completely bonkers."
The lawyer made the comments after Najib was granted a discharge not amounting to an acquittal over three money laundering charges on Feb 7.
However, Najib was slapped with the same three charges the following day.
Shafee subsequently held a press conference, whereby he is alleged to have insinuated that the move involved an influence on the judge and witnesses, as well as fabrication of evidence. - Mkini
